Specifications
- Display: 19″ capacitive touchscreen, 1280 ร 1024 resolution
- Parameters: ECG (3/5/12-lead), SpOโ, NIBP, IBP, Temp, COโ, Respiration, BIS, EEG (depending on module setup)
- Communication: HL7, LAN, WLAN, USB, serial port, and IntelliBridge integration
- Alarm Management: Prioritized, multi-level visual and audible alerts with suppression and delay settings
- Data Storage: Includes trends, waveforms, event review, and full disclosure capabilities
- Compatibility: Works with IntelliVue X2, MMS, and MX-series modules
- Power: AC and battery backup options (varies by configuration)
- Mounting Options: Wall mount, boom arm, roll stand, or shelf-mounted setup
- Weight: Approx. 8.2 kg (18 lbs), excluding accessories

Troubleshooting help:
Default Passwords for Monitor :
Configuration Mode: 71034
Demo Mode: 14432
Service Mode: 1345
Default Admin Password: 2104
